6 个最好的 Python IDE 和代码编辑器 | Linux 中国
Python,作为现代编程语言的代表,广泛应用于网站开发、应用程序构建、数据科学、人工智能以及物联网设备等领域。因此,选择合适的开发环境对于Python开发者来说至关重要。本文将介绍六个适用于Linux和Windows操作系统的最佳Python代码编辑器,旨在帮助开发者根据自己的需求和使用情况选择最合适的工具。
1. **Visual Studio Code**
Visual Studio Code虽然由微软开发,但因其强大的功能和跨语言支持而成为众多开发者首选的代码编辑器。它具备语法高亮、代码补全、调试、代码片段、内置Git等功能,对于Python开发尤其友好。虽然对于初学者可能略显复杂,但只需几小时的学习即可掌握其基本操作。Visual Studio Code支持Linux、macOS和Windows操作系统。
2. **Eclipse with PyDev插件**
Eclipse是由IBM开发的一款全面的集成开发环境(IDE),原主要用于Java和Android开发,但也能支持多种编程语言,包括Python。通过集成PyDev插件,Eclipse可成为完整的Python开发环境。用户可享受编译、代码分析、实时调试、交互式控制台访问等丰富功能。
3. **PyCharm**
由JetBrains开发的PyCharm,专为Python开发者设计,提供智能代码补全、代码检查、即时错误高亮、快速修复等功能。它还集成了调试器、测试运行器、Python解析器、内置终端和版本控制系统集成等工具。PyCharm支持Python网页开发,还提供对多种框架、语言的支持,适合科学和网页开发。
4. **Spyder**
Spyder是一个专为科学家和数据科学家设计的强大Python编辑器,使用Python编写。它集成了高级编辑、分析、调试和剖析功能,同时结合了科学软件包的数据探索、交互式执行、深度检查和可视化功能。适用于科学计算和数据科学项目。
5. **Sublime Text**
Sublime Text是一个功能强大的代码编辑器,支持Python编程,适用于跨平台使用。它提供了如“Goto anywhere”等提高生产力的功能,支持许多编程语言,并允许用户通过插件扩展其功能。
6. **Thonny Python编辑器**
Thonny是一个面向初学者的Python IDE,设计简洁,易于上手。它内置了最新的Python版本,并提供了基本的开发工具,如变量视图、调试器和语法错误处理。适合Python新手使用。
除上述编辑器外,还有如VIM、IDLE、Cloud 9和Emacs等值得关注的Python编辑器。本文提供了一个全面的概览,帮助开发者根据自己的需求和经验选择最适合的工具。
多重随机标签